James Mac Sweeney is an associate in the Corporate Department of the London office of Latham & Watkins, and a member of the Capital Markets Practice.

Mr. Mac Sweeney represents investment banks, private equity firms, and corporations in public and private equity and debt offerings, with a particular emphasis on issuances of high yield debt securities.

Mr. Mac Sweeney has represented:

  • EnQuest plc, an upstream oil and gas company focused on North Sea and Malaysian production, in connection with its offering of US$305 million senior notes;
  • Lowell Group, a leading provider of credit management services specializing in credit management and data analytics, in connection with over £1.6 billion senior secured notes;
  • Lowell Group in connection with its private placement of over £100 million of senior secured notes;
  • Intrum AB in its offering of €800 million of senior notes due 2026 and its offering of €850 million senior notes due 2027
  • Tullow Oil plc in connection with the tender offer of a total aggregate principal amount of US$166.5 million of its senior notes due 2025;
  • The initial purchasers on the €400 million Senior Secured Notes and €250 million Senior Secured Floating Rate Notes of Bite Group, a Lithuanian telecommunications and media company
  • The initial purchasers in connection with financing supporting the take private by KIRKBI, Blackstone, and CPPIB of Merlin Entertainment
